ZW140
ENGINE
| Model | Cummins QSB4.5 |
| Type | 4-cycle water-cooled, direct injection |
| Aspiration | Turbocharger and charge air cooled |
| No. of cylinders | 4 |
| Maximum power SAE J1349, Without Fan net | 96 kW (129 HP) at 2 000 min-1(rpm) |
| Maximum power ISO 9249, Without Fan net | 96 kW (129 HP) at 2 000 min-1(rpm) |
| Maximum power EEC 80/1269, Without Fan net | 96 kW (129 HP) at 2 000 min-1(rpm) |
| Bore and stroke | 107 mm x 124 mm |
| Piston displacement | 4.46 L |
| Batteries | 2 x 12 V 620CCA, 80Ah, 140-min rated reserve |
| Air cleaner | Two element dry type with restriction indicator |

AXLE AND FINAL DRIVE
| Drive system | Four-wheel drive system |
| Front & rear axle | Semi-floating |
| Front | Fixed to the front frame |
| Rear | Center pivot |
| Reduction and differential gear | Two stage reduction with torque proportioning differential |
| Oscillation angle | Total 20 degree (+10 degree , -10 degree) |
| Final drives | Planetary final drive |
TIRES (tubeless, nylon body)
| Standard | 17.5-25 12PR (L3) |
BRAKES
| Service brakes | Inboard mounted fully hydraulic 4 wheel wet disc brake HST(Hydro Static Transmission) system provides additional hydraulic braking capacity |
| Parking brake | Spring applied, hydraulically released, wet disc type with drive through prevention mechanism |
STEERING SYSTEM
| Type | Articulated frame steering |
| Steering mechanism | Fully hydraulic power steering with orbitrol |
| Steering angle | Each direction 40 degree ; total 80 degree |
| Relief pressure | 19.6 MPa (200 kgf/cm2) |
| Cylinders | Two double-acting piston type |
| Cylinders No. x Bore x Stroke | 2 x 65 mm x 419 mm |
| Minimum turning radius at the centerline of outside tire | 4 950 mm |
HYDRAULIC SYSTEM
Arm and bucket are controlled by Joystick lever
| Arm controls | Three position valve ; Raise, lower, float |
| Bucket controls with automatic bucket returnto-dig controls | Three position valve ; Roll back, hold, dump |
| Main pump (Load & steer) | Gear type 159 L/min at 2 200 min-1 (rpm) at 20.6 MPa (210 kgf/cm2) |
| Relief pressure setting | 20.6 MPa (210 kgf/cm2) |
| HST charging pump | Gear type 41L /min at 2 200 min-1 (rpm) at 2.5 MPa (25 kgf/cm2) |
| Transmission charging pump | Gear type 17 L/min at 2 200 min-1 (rpm) at 1.96 MPa (20 kgf/cm2) |
| Transmission charging Fan pump | Gear type 30 L/min at 2 200 min-1 (rpm) at 11.8 MPa (120 kgf/cm2) |
| Hydraulic cylinders Type | Two arm and one bucket, double acting type |
| Hydraulic cylinders No. x Bore x Stroke | Arm : 2 x 125 mm x 620 mm Bucket : 1 x 150 mm x 445 mm |
| Filters | Full-flow 10 micron return filter in reservoir |
| Hydraulic cycle times lift arm raise | 6.0 s |
| Hydraulic cycle times lower | 3.0 s |
| Hydraulic cycle times bucket dump | 1.3 s |
| Hydraulic cycle times total | 10.3 s |
SERVICE REFILL CAPACITIES
| Fuel tank | 180.0 L |
| Engine coolant | 25.0 L |
| Engine oil | 14.0 L |
| Transmission gear box | 10.0 L |
| Front axle differential & wheel hubs | 24.0 L |
| Rear axle differential & wheel hubs | 25.0 L |
| Hydraulic reservoir tank | 80.0 L |
